The Sunseeker Predator 82, launched in 2007, is a sophisticated and high-performance luxury motor yacht that blends striking design, powerful engineering, and a luxurious interior. Built for those who appreciate both speed and elegance, the Predator 82 delivers a thrilling cruising experience while offering ultimate comfort and style for guests on board.
The sleek and dynamic exterior design of the Predator 82 is a hallmark of Sunseeker’s renowned style. The yacht features a deep-V hull that ensures stability and an exhilarating ride. With large sunbathing areas, a fully equipped cockpit, and a hydraulic bathing platform, this yacht is ideal for those who love to entertain or relax in the sun. The garage accommodates a tender or jet ski. The yacht can accommodate up to 8 guests in 4 spacious cabins, including a master suite, a VIP stateroom, and two twin cabins. Each cabin is finished with the finest materials, ensuring a serene and opulent retreat. The open-plan saloon includes large windows to flood the space with natural light, and the galley is equipped with state-of-the-art appliances for gourmet cooking on board.
The yacht also features a large dining area and a comfortable lounge where guests can unwind or entertain.

All prices generated as a guide. Availability subject to confirmation. Gratuity discretionary, typically 5%–25% of the base price.

Variable expenses — fuel, food, marina fees — are deducted from an Advance Provisioning Allowance (APA), an additional deposit added to the charter price. The remainder is returned after charter.
